Output 626f62abfb6753991dcae5f5822d8b5f12013b58c31a88cda316fa7bd4f5620b:0

value
162277460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55af255c795f93e7902af1479382c67e977c86e OP_EQUAL
address
MQS5VEVr2kjjNUopXZw4XnUGFe65QqFXqm
transaction
626f62abfb6753991dcae5f5822d8b5f12013b58c31a88cda316fa7bd4f5620b
spent
true